# This code must be source compatible with Python 2.6 through 3.3.

"""Import this module to add a hook to call pdb on uncaught exceptions.

To enable this, do the following in your top-level application:

import google.apputils.debug

and then in your main():

google.apputils.debug.Init()

Then run your program with --pdb.
"""



import sys

import gflags as flags

flags.DEFINE_boolean('pdb', 0, 'Drop into pdb on uncaught exceptions')

old_excepthook = None


def _DebugHandler(exc_class, value, tb):
  if not flags.FLAGS.pdb or hasattr(sys, 'ps1') or not sys.stderr.isatty():
    # we aren't in interactive mode or we don't have a tty-like
    # device, so we call the default hook
    old_excepthook(exc_class, value, tb)
  else:
    # Don't impose import overhead on apps that never raise an exception.
    import traceback
    import pdb
    # we are in interactive mode, print the exception...
    traceback.print_exception(exc_class, value, tb)
    sys.stdout.write('\n')
    # ...then start the debugger in post-mortem mode.
    pdb.pm()


def Init():
  # Must back up old excepthook.
  global old_excepthook  # pylint: disable=global-statement
  if old_excepthook is None:
    old_excepthook = sys.excepthook
    sys.excepthook = _DebugHandler
